Understanding Macquarie’s Loan Options

Macquarie offers a variety of loans to meet different financial needs. For personal loans, you can get funds for home improvements, buying a car, or paying off debts. You can choose between fixed or variable interest rates, depending on your financial situation.

Business loans from Macquarie help entrepreneurs and companies grow. These loans can cover expenses like cash flow, equipment, or expanding your business. Your business’s performance and credit history are key to getting approved.

Macquarie also has home loans for both first-time buyers and investors. You can enjoy competitive interest rates and flexible repayment terms. Plus, there are tools to help you compare loans and make the best choice for your finances.

Preparing Your Loan Application

Getting ready for a Macquarie loan application needs focus. You must collect all needed documents before you start. This includes proof of who you are, like a driver’s license or passport, and proof of how much you earn, such as pay slips or tax returns.

Having a good credit history is also key. A strong credit score shows you’re good with money. Knowing this helps when you apply for a loan at Macquarie bank. By preparing well and making sure your info is right, you can make a strong case for your loan.

The Step-by-Step Submission Process

Applying for a loan at Macquarie Bank is straightforward. First, you need to find the loan application form on the bank’s website. This form asks for important details for the loan review.

When you’re on the application page, fill it out with care. Make sure your personal and financial info is correct. Any errors could slow down your application. You’ll also need to upload documents like proof of income and ID.

After you’ve filled out the form and uploaded your documents, you can submit your application. It’s a good idea to check the status of your application online. Knowing what to expect from the bank can help you answer any questions they might have.

What to Expect After Submission

After you send in your loan request to Macquarie, you’ll go through a detailed check. They first look at the documents you provided. Things like your credit score, how much you earn, and your job are important.

How long it takes to get a response can vary. But, you usually hear back within a few days. Macquarie might ask for more info or documents during this time. Knowing this can help you be ready for any questions they might have.

If your loan isn’t approved, Macquarie lets you appeal. It’s a good idea to look at any feedback they give you. Also, gather more info that could help your appeal. Being active in this step can increase your chances of getting the loan next time.

Common Reasons for Loan Request Denials

Many things can cause a loan application to be turned down at Macquarie Bank. Knowing why can help improve your chances of getting approved next time. A big issue is a low credit score, which shows you might not handle money well. Lenders see this as a risk and might not approve your loan.

Not having enough income is another big problem. If you can’t show you make enough money, the bank might think you can’t pay back the loan. Also, if your financial info doesn’t match up, it can cause big issues. This can lead to a bad review of your application.

Not having enough collateral is also a big factor. If the collateral doesn’t meet the bank’s standards, they might see it as too risky. Understanding these reasons can help you fix problems before you apply.
